Presentation of the livestock farm

Good milk quality. – UAA: 66 ha (natural grassland: 35; temporary grassland: 20; grain: 8; sowing under cover: 3)

Frédéric Garnier grazes his cows all year round. Since the installation of his Boumatic robot in December 2017, they go out after the morning robot run until 3pm. The cows therefore enjoy a semi-complete mixed ration every day. This ration is made up of 20 kg of grass silage, 5 kg of maize
cobs (bales), 2 kg of lucerne hay bought, 3 kg of cereals to the robot and 2 kg of nitrogen corrector (on average).

Before I went organic, I used yeast that was incorporated directly into the mineral. But in 2015, I ran out of solutions, so I immediately accepted when I was told about Delta® Fibrae UAB. I distribute 50g of it every day at the trough, along with a mineral and chestnut tannin. I have noticed that the ration was refused much less often. Also, feed intake is better, so the basic ration is better used. My animals are moving well and milk production is holding up well, despite an advanced average month. For me, as an organic farmer, live yeasts are an excellent solution for easing dietary transitions and optimising my herd’s production throughout lactation…

Yeasts that can be used in organic farming with Delta® Fibrae UAB

In March 2018, thanks to advice from his cooperative, Frédéric introduced Delta® Fibrae UAB for grazing or for the transition from winter ration to pasture. Delta® Fibrae UAB is a natural product containing live yeasts. These yeasts increase fibre digestibility: +89% on the ADF fibre fraction (source: publication from Journal of Dairy Science: Marden et al., 2008). Delta® Fibrae UAB values forages and improves digestive comfort: more digested fibre = less waste in dung.
The feed value of the ration is thus improved.
